How Long Does Chicken Salad Last in the Fridge
FoodKeeper lists chicken salad at about 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ator and says freezing is not recommended.

What the official refrigerated storage guidance means for chicken salad
FoodKeeper lists chicken salad at about 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ator and says freezing is not recommended.
For chicken salad, the official window only makes sense when you pair it with how the item was actually stored, handled, and served at home. Warm exposure, repeated opening, contamination, and missing open dates can matter just as much as the printed date.
How to store chicken salad
Treat chicken salad like a short-window prepared food, not like a long-life condiment.
Use the package directions first. FoodKeeper storage windows are useful guidance, but they are not a blanket guarantee that a product is always safe until that exact day.
Signs chicken salad should be discarded or replaced
- Discard if the salad has been left warm too long or is obviously spoiled.
- Do not rely on freezing as a default storage plan here; FoodKeeper says freezing is not recommended.
- When in doubt, throw it out.
